Column is a nationally chartered bank built for developers, offering direct bank APIs for payments, lending, and accounts without an intermediary sponsor bank layer.
Column is a nationally chartered bank founded in 2021 that is built from the ground up as a developer-first financial infrastructure company. Unlike BaaS providers that sit on top of sponsor banks, Column is itself a federally chartered bank with a national bank charter, meaning fintechs and technology companies can access banking infrastructure without an intermediary and with direct access to Federal Reserve payment rails. The company offers APIs for ACH, wire transfers, real-time payments, account creation, and card issuing, with straightforward and transparent pricing compared to the multi-layer fees common in traditional BaaS stacks. Column raised over $100M and serves fintech companies, technology platforms, and lending businesses that need reliable and cost-efficient banking infrastructure with deep API access. Holding a national bank charter allows Column to offer more competitive economics and simpler compliance structures than BaaS platforms relying on third-party sponsor banks. Column represents the most vertically integrated approach to developer banking, eliminating the intermediary layer that adds cost and complexity in traditional BaaS architectures.

goodfin is a Santa Monica-based AI-powered wealth management platform that provides high-net-worth individuals and startup founders with access to alternative investments — private equity, venture capital, and pre-IPO company shares — that are typically available only to institutional investors and ultra-high-net-worth family offices. Founded in 2022 and backed by Giant Ventures and Y Combinator with $4 million in seed funding, goodfin uses AI to provide personalized alternative investment recommendations, portfolio construction, and automated rebalancing that enables sophisticated investors to diversify beyond public markets.
